    Try this:


    -----------------------
    Manual Recovery


    1. Format USB Stick with Fat 32 first.
    2. In USB root create new txt file and rename it to _recovery_facinit. Without file extension (.txt should be removed) and in your USB Root (/) should be only "_recovery_facinit"
    3. Insert USB in your Z Series Box
    4. Disconnect power (unplug the Cable) from your Box and power on again
    6. "!!! at the same time (important) !!!" , press CH UP on RCU continuously. Click CH UP button continuously,, clik clik clik clik ...... right after plug in.
    7. Android update animation will appear. (Stop pressing CH UP button now)
    8. it will factory reset with Android Logo if it works.
    A. If you don't see "android logo" and box boots like normal situation, there must be something wrong.
    (Please retry. maybe you can click CH up button before plug in the power)
    B. If you see "Android logo" with ERROR message, the box cannot be reset with manual factory and needs to be repaired.


    * “_recovery_facinit” file will be deleted from the USB once it is used correctly for one receiver.
    To use for another receiver, you may want to create the file again.

    Test procedure.

    • FW - 1.2.16
    • MYTVO - 1.9.6
    • Software and Factory reset done under [lexicon]settings[/lexicon]. New install and set all needed.


    Used sd cards.

    • Patriot 32GB - Formatted with Fat32 - works fine
    • Sandisk 32GB - Formatted with NFS - works fine
    • Samsung 64GB - Formatted with exFAT - issue

    For formatting devices like SD Cards and USB Sticks i use always only Rufus tool. Rufus 2.18 -> https://rufus.akeo.ie/?locale=en_US
    Check Box activate only "Quick Format".



    After 2 hours continues testing with 2 different sd cards and maybe >20 box restarts i was not able to reproduce the issue, not even once! Did Recordings, Timeshift, even scheduler Recording trough EPG and send box in standby, before the movie started the box goes ON and recorded. Must say this is the best MYTVO since beginning.


    At end i took Samsung sd card from my old phone and formatted with exFAT. First all worked well and after restart i was finally able to reproduce the issue, only pull out helps. Ok, took the same card and formatted with nfs, works now very well like the other sandisk, even after 4 restarts no problems.
    Please format your sd cards again, with fat32 or nfs with Rufus tool but not with exFAT.
